Transaction 843b1dc1540e8aadaa8e2436479c739c5b993499e2f4ae78a3d17918bda6d521

2 Input
1 Outputs
  • 843b1dc1540e8aadaa8e2436479c739c5b993499e2f4ae78a3d17918bda6d521:0
  • value  3620116
    address  39MCCRpf9ZmyKMVsbAeKCFW28HhPJYx6cZ